Schiefferts, Drake win 4-H Open Class Market Hog titles

Staff photo by Fritz Busch Mady Drake of the Comfrey Comets shows awards she won at the 4-H Open Class Market Hog Show at the Brown County Fair Friday.

NEW ULM — Olivia, Stella and Joe Schieffert of Sleepy Eye and Mady Drake of Comfrey dominated the 4-H Open Class Market Hog show at the Brown County Fair Friday.

Drake, 10, of the Comfrey Comets 4-H Club, showed the Champion Market Hog and Champion Market Boar.

“I like working with pigs. They’re fun to walk,” Drake said, about “Jack,” her cross-bred boar. She is active in the Just For Kix danceline and enjoys fishing.

Olivia Schieffert, 9, has been raising pigs for five years. She showed the Grand Champion Market Gilt. Stella Schieffert, 7, showed the Reserve Champion Market Gilt.

“It’s fun. It gives me something to do in summer,” Olivia Schieffert said. “We raise and sell baby pigs at my great grandma’s farm.”

Olivia Schieffert’s other interests are volleyball, basketball and softball.

Stella Schieffert, 7, began raising pigs three years ago. The Schieffert girls belong to the Sleepy Eye Wide Awakes 4-H Club.

Joe Schieffert of Sleepy Eye showed the Reserve Champion Overall Market Hog and Market Gilt.

Taylor Franz of Bingham Lake showed the Reserve Champion Market Boar.
